Section 3.3075 - Minimum Standards for Disability Income Protection Coverage

"Disability income protection coverage" is a policy which provides for periodic payments, weekly or monthly, for a specified period during the continuance of disability resulting from either sickness or accident or a combination thereof, which:

(1) provides for periodic payments in an amount of at least $100 per month payable at ages through 62 and $50 per month at ages after 62;
(2) contains an elimination period no greater than:
(A) 90 days in the case of a coverage providing a benefit period of one year or less;
(B) 365 days if the benefit is payable for not less than two years and is payable in an amount of at least $200 per month; or
(C) 180 days in all other cases during the continuance of disability resulting from sickness or injury;
(3) has a maximum period of time for which it is payable during disability of at least six months;
(4) this section does not apply to those policies providing business buy out coverage.
